Each PANCE or PANRE Practice Exam includes 120 multiple-choice questions divided into two sections of 60 questions each. PAs can choose time intervals based on their needs. Without testing accommodations, PAs have 60 minutes to complete each section for a total of two hours of exam time.For example, approximately 3% of the PANCE content blueprint is comprised of hematology questions. Thus, on the 120-question Practice Exam, there would be only 3 to 4 questions in this content area. It is important to keep in mind that performance on a small number of items is less reliable than with a larger number of items. All applicants can take PANCE once in a 90-day period or three times a year, whichever is fewer. Pancreatitis is inflammation in your pancreas. It’s usually temporary (acute) but can also be a life-long (chronic) condition. The most common symptom is abdominal pain. The most common causes are alcohol use and gallstones. Feb 1, 2022 · To be licensed in any state as a PA, you’ll first need to pass your boards — the PA National Certifying Examination (PANCE). And to be eligible for the PANCE, you’ll first need to graduate from PA school. PANCE results can take up to two weeks. Between each testing session is a 15-minute break, resulting in 45 minutes of total break time. The remaining 15 minutes in the 5-hour block are for candidates to complete a PANRE tutorial at the beginning of the exam.Pass the PANCE and receive the Physician Assistant-Certified (PA-C) credential, which is offered by the National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ants. Link to this page:May 26, 2022 · You have five hours to complete it, including a 45-minute break and 15 minutes for software training. Because the PANCE is administered approximately 355 days per calendar year in Pearson VUE’s 200 testing centers, scheduling and taking the exam shouldn’t add more than a few days to your journey to become a PA.

PANCE is a multiple choice exam which assesses basic medical and surgical knowledge.
